- Economic Growth: A growing economy generally leads to higher corporate earnings, which can drive stock prices higher. When the Philippine economy is booming, companies tend to perform better, leading to increased investor confidence and higher stock valuations. Keep an eye on GDP growth figures and other economic indicators to gauge the overall health of the Philippine economy. Economic growth is a key driver of stock market performance, so it's important to stay informed about the latest economic trends.
- Interest Rates: Lower interest rates can make borrowing cheaper for companies, encouraging investment and expansion. This can also boost stock prices. When interest rates are low, companies can borrow money more easily, which can fuel growth and profitability. Additionally, low interest rates can make stocks more attractive relative to bonds, as investors seek higher returns in the stock market. Monitoring interest rate decisions by the Bangko Sentral ng Pilipinas (BSP) can provide insights into the direction of the PSEI.
- Inflation: High inflation can erode corporate profits and consumer spending, potentially leading to lower stock prices. Inflation reduces the purchasing power of consumers and increases the cost of doing business for companies. This can lead to lower earnings and slower economic growth, which can negatively impact stock prices. Keeping an eye on inflation figures and the BSP's response to inflation is crucial for understanding the outlook for the PSEI. The BSP's monetary policy decisions can have a significant impact on the stock market.
- Government Policies: Government policies, such as tax reforms and infrastructure spending, can also impact the stock market. Supportive government policies can create a favorable environment for businesses, leading to increased investment and higher stock prices. For example, tax cuts can boost corporate profits, while infrastructure spending can stimulate economic growth. Conversely, unfavorable government policies can dampen investor sentiment and lead to lower stock prices. Monitoring government policy announcements and their potential impact on the economy and businesses is essential for investors.
- Global Events: Global events, such as trade wars, geopolitical tensions, and pandemics, can also have a significant impact on the PSEI. These events can create uncertainty and volatility in the market, leading to sharp price swings. For example, a trade war between major economies can disrupt global supply chains and reduce economic growth, while a pandemic can lead to lockdowns and business closures. Monitoring global events and their potential impact on the Philippine economy and stock market is crucial for managing risk and making informed investment decisions. Global events can have a ripple effect on local markets, so it's important to stay informed about developments around the world.

Understanding Stock Forecasts
First things first, what is a stock forecast? A stock forecast is an attempt to predict the future price of a company's stock or a market index like the PSEI. These forecasts are often based on a variety of factors, including historical data, economic indicators, and company-specific news. There are two main types of analysis used in stock forecasting: technical analysis and fundamental analysis.
Technical analysis involves studying past market data, such as price and volume, to identify patterns and trends that can be used to predict future price movements. Technical analysts use various tools and techniques, including charts, indicators, and oscillators, to analyze this data. The underlying assumption is that history tends to repeat itself, and by recognizing these patterns, traders can make informed decisions about when to buy or sell stocks. However, technical analysis is not foolproof and should be used in conjunction with other forms of analysis.
Fundamental analysis, on the other hand, involves evaluating a company's financial health, competitive position, and industry outlook to determine its intrinsic value. Fundamental analysts examine financial statements, such as the balance sheet, income statement, and cash flow statement, to assess a company's profitability, solvency, and efficiency. They also consider macroeconomic factors, such as interest rates, inflation, and economic growth, as well as industry-specific trends and competitive dynamics. By comparing a company's intrinsic value to its current market price, investors can determine whether a stock is overvalued, undervalued, or fairly priced.
It's super important to remember that forecasts aren't crystal balls! They're educated guesses based on available information. Lots of things can throw a wrench in the works, from unexpected economic shifts to global events. Don't treat them as gospel, but rather as a piece of the puzzle in your investment strategy. While these forecasts are valuable tools for investors, they should not be the sole basis for investment decisions. Instead, investors should consider a range of factors, including their own risk tolerance, investment goals, and time horizon, as well as the advice of qualified financial professionals.
